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Sunshine Coast Airport to Hamilton Island is to bus and ferry via Shute Harbour Marine Terminal which costs $200 - $360 and takes 21h 1m.
The fastest way to get from Sunshine Coast Airport to Hamilton Island is to fly which takes 5h 15m and costs $370 - $800.
The distance between Sunshine Coast Airport and Hamilton Island is 813 km.
The best way to get from Sunshine Coast Airport to Hamilton Island without a car is to train and ferry which takes 17h 22m and costs $190 - $3,800.
It takes approximately 5h 15m to fly from Sunshine Coast Airport (MCY) to Great Barrier Reef Airport (HTI), including transfers and time at the airport.
There is no direct flight from Sunshine Coast Airport Airport to Great Barrier Reef Airport Airport. The quickest flight takes 5h 15m and has one stopover.
Jetstar, Virgin Australia and Qantas offer flights from Sunshine Coast Airport Airport to Great Barrier Reef Airport Airport.
